When Will Electricity Come Back in Soteba?
- Unplanned fault
- Most outages in Soteba restore within 4-8 hours; a tripped feeder in 2-4 hours.
- Cable theft / vandalism
- 12-48 hours where a substation or mini-sub must be repaired.
- Storm damage
- Depends on access and number of faults; widespread damage can take over a day.

Is it load shedding or a power outage in Soteba?
If your power is off outside the published load shedding schedule, Soteba is likely experiencing an unplanned outage - a fault, cable theft or equipment failure - not load shedding.
